         <description><![CDATA[<div>Connecticut labor law generally requires employers to pay their employees the same wage rate,<br>regardless of their sex, for performing equal work that requires equal skill, effort, and responsibility<br>under similar working conditions.</div>]]></description>

         <title>how to deal with the problem? and the penalty</title>
         <author>ksoa0295</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/ksoa0295/55brlypb3gxajf4m/wish/2565974816</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ol><li>Fines: The violating employer could be fined for each instance of pay discrimination. The amount of the fine could vary based on the severity and frequency of the violation.</li><li>Back pay: The employer could be required to provide back pay to any employee who was paid less than their colleagues for substantially similar work.</li><li>Injunctions: A court could issue an injunction requiring the employer to change their pay practices and bring them in line with the law.</li><li>Damages: Employees who were discriminated against could be awarded damages for any harm they suffered as a result of the discrimination, such as emotional distress or career damage.</li><li>Revocation of business licenses: In some cases, a business license could be revoked for repeated or egregious violations of equal pay laws.</li></ol><div><br></div><div><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>purpose of law</title>
         <author>ksoa0295</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/ksoa0295/55brlypb3gxajf4m/wish/2565979916</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>The purpose of the Equal Pay Act is to eliminate pay discrimination based on gender, race, or other characteristics and to ensure that employees are paid fairly and equitably for jobs that require similar skills, effort, and responsibilities under similar working conditions. The main objective is to promote equality and fairness in the workplace, eliminating pay discrimination and helping to combat systemic inequality. The law seeks to ensure that all employees are evaluated for their work and qualifications, rather than being discriminated against based on personal characteristics.</div>]]></description>
